Same here. Our misalignment developed on the front when an entire headlamp assembly was replaced shortly after we received the car (another story). Anyway, we returned to complain about the new fitment. We were told there's not much there to adjust as it's all plastic on plastic, which I understood. Still, the service guy did a little massaging and made some improvement. He said he's even seen them move as the plastic heats up in sunlight. Regardless, ours looks acceptable now ... no charges, no paperwork.
